'More drivers face parking penalties'

'More drivers face parking penalties'

Drivers who already have numerous costs - such as fuel bills or motor trade insurance payments - may also have faced paying parking penalties over the last few years.

According to the Telegraph, the number of motorists shelling out for parking tickets has increased fivefold in the last six years.

Citing figures from the Traffic Penalty Tribunal, the publication states that between 2006 and 2007, a tenth of all drivers received parking tickets.

Some 3.58 million drivers had to pay parking penalties in 2006-07, compared with 794,851 in 2000-01.

A further increase is expected to be recorded this year to reflect the fact that the past year has seen about a fifth of local councils become responsible for their area's parking enforcement.

Revisions were recently made to the parking laws, with people who wrongly use disabled spaces now expected to pay out £70 for doing so.
